To enhance immunity, there are several steps you can take to support and strengthen your immune system. Here are some practical strategies:


Eat a healthy and balanced diet: Include a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ats in your meals. These foods provide essential nutrients, vitamins, and minerals that support immune function.

Stay hydrated: Drink an adequate amount of water throughout the day. Water helps in flushing out toxins from the body and keeps your cells hydrated, which is important for optimal immune function.

Get regular exercise: Engage in mo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week. Exercise improves blood circulation, reduces stress, and enhances immune system activity.


Prioritize sleep: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. During sleep, your body repairs and rejuvenates itself, including the immune system. Lack of sleep can weaken your immune response.


Manage stress: Chronic stress can suppress immune function. Practice stress management techniques like deep breathing, meditation, yoga, or engaging in hobbies and activities you enjoy.



Maintain a healthy weight: Obesity has been linked to weakened immune function. Adopting a healthy lifestyle that includes a balanced diet and regular exercise can help you maintain a healthy weight and support your immune system.


Avoid smoking and excessive alcohol consumption: Smoking and excessive alcohol intake can impair immune function and increase your susceptibility to infections. Quit smoking and limit alcohol to moderate levels or avoid it altogether.

Practice good hygiene: Wash your hands frequently with soap and water for at least 20 seconds, especially before eating and after using the restroom. Avoid touching your face, particularly your eyes, nose, and mouth, as it can facilitate the entry of pathogens.

Consider supplements: While a balanced diet should provide most of the necessary nutrients, certain supplements can support immune health, such as vitamin C, vitamin D, zinc, and probiotics. Consult with a healthcare professional before starting any supplements.

Stay up to date with vaccinations: Vaccinations are a crucial way to prevent infectious diseases and strengthen your immune system’s ability to fight off specific pathogens.
